We have a brand new opportunity for a Remuneration and Benefits Analyst to join our Human Resources team, based in our Barangaroo, Sydney office. This is a permanent position.

CMC Markets is a global leader in CFD trading and share investing. Our vision is to provide the ultimate online trading experience so everyone can achieve their financial potential. Since our launch in London in 1989, we’ve expanded globally with offices across Europe and Asia Pacific. Over 1.2 million clients make 67 million trades with us every year, and we’re still growing.

As the Remuneration & Benefits Analyst you will work across the broad-based remuneration portfolio to provide advice and guidance to the HR team and the broader business on our remuneration framework, policies and processes. You will perform detailed analysis and modelling of internal and external remuneration data to draw insights and support business decision making. The role will lead compensation and benefits activities, services, systems and reporting.

Role & Responsibilities
- Managing the remuneration programs and cyclical activities such as the annual remuneration review, market matching/pricing, superannuation offering and employee share plans.
- Undertaking internal and external remuneration benchmarking to support Leaders and the HR team in remuneration decision making.
- Prepare company remuneration data and complete industry salary surveys using judgement and remuneration knowledge to map company data into external templates.
- Undertake remuneration governance activity to ensure compliance with relevant legislation and modern awards.
- Monitoring remuneration trends and review market data and benefits to benchmark CMC Markets’ practices and programs.
- Identify trends and implement new practices to engage and motivate employees.
- Coordinating and rolling out the annual performance cycle through the HR Business Partners.
- Ownership for the data management activities which underpin the annual salary review process.
- Managing the employee benefit program and annual calendar of events. This involves relationship management of vendors and internal stakeholders, promotion of the program and responding to employee queries.
- Providing assistance to payroll as needed to ensure the accurate and timely processing of any remuneration and benefit plans.
- Implementation of new initiatives and remuneration change programs.
- Assisting in the governance of the remuneration framework
- Complex data modelling to support key remuneration activities, e.g. gender equity pay review and employee incentive programs
- Regular and ad-hoc reporting on HR metrics and activities.
- Maintain personal/professional development to meet the changing demands of the role, including all relevant regulatory and legislative training.
- When dealing with all customers, clients or colleagues ensure that we provide a clear, fair, and consistent high-quality service that presents a professional and positive image of CMC Markets.

Key Skills & Experience

Required:

- Demonstrated experience (5+ years) in remuneration and human resource roles within a corporate environment.
- Demonstrated ability to execute enterprise-wide projects (e.g. remuneration review) through working effectively with others.
- Knowledge of building compensation packages and bonus programs for various departments and seniority levels.
- Proven ability to be analytical & handle data effectively with the ability to understand the market and trends over time.
- Experience in creating information from raw data sources.
- Knowledge of contemporary remuneration and benefit practices, employment taxes, legislation, and market practice.
- People management experience preferred, but not essential

Qualification/s required

Relevant tertiary qualifications in business, HR or related discipline.
